BiRefNet 是什么?
BiRefNet 是用于背景去除和抠图的模型。
正式来说,它是用于 Dichotomous Image Segmentation (DIS) 的模型,也就是把图像分成 前景 和 背景 两部分。
它并不是像 SAM 那样,通过“这个点”“这个框”“这个物体”来指定并生成蒙版。BiRefNet 更擅长从头发、植物等细节复杂的对象中,生成高质量的切出蒙版。

- 使用
Load Background Removal Model读取birefnet.safetensors。 - 将图像和模型输入
Remove Background后,会输出用于背景去除的MASK。 - 想要背景透明的图像时,使用
Join Image with Alpha。- 但如果直接使用这个蒙版,前景会变透明,所以中间要接一个
Invert Mask。

填充背景
上面的 workflow 会把背景变为透明,但作为图像生成或分析的预处理使用时,把背景填充成单色通常更容易处理。

- 将原图、反转后的蒙版、单色图像输入
Image Composite Masked。 - 只把被蒙版选中的背景部分替换为单色图像。
